Hundreds protest against Turkey’s withdrawal from landmark women’s treaty

Hundreds of women across Turkey on Saturday took to the streets for the second weekend in a row to protest against President Recep Tayyip Erdogan’s decision to withdraw from the world’s first binding treaty to combat violence against women.Erdogan last weekend sparked anger with his withdrawal from the 2011 Istanbul Convention that conservatives claim is hurting family unity in Turkey.Justifying the decision to withdraw, the presidency last week claimed the treaty had been “hijacked by a group…
